classify the cost elements shown below for the impressive printing company into the proper quality cost categories.\ncost element amount quality cost category\ncustomer complaint remakes $21,700 select\nprinting plate revisions $27,300 select\nquality improvement projects $10,600 appraisal\ngauging $104,000 external failure\nother waste $36,000 internal failure\ncorrection of typographical errors $184,000 select\nproofreading $410,000 select\nquality planning $58,000 select\npress downtime $220,300 select\nbindery waste $47,600 select\nchecking and inspection $30,400 select\nfind the total quality cost by category and percentage of total quality cost by category. do not round intermediate calculations. round the monetary values to the nearest dollar and percentage values to two decimal places.\nquality cost category total amount percentage of total quality cost\nprevention $\nappraisal $\ninternal failure $\nexternal failure $\n

Explanation:

Step1: Categorize cost elements

  • Prevention costs are incurred to avoid quality problems. Quality - improvement projects ($10,600) and quality planning ($58,000) are prevention costs. Total prevention cost = $10,600 + $58,000=$68,600.
  • Appraisal costs are for checking and ensuring quality. Gauging ($104,000), proofreading ($410,000), and checking and inspection ($30,400) are appraisal costs. Total appraisal cost = $104,000 + $410,000+ $30,400 = $544,400.
  • Internal - failure costs occur when defects are found before the product reaches the customer. Printing plate revisions ($27,300), other waste ($36,000), correction of typographical errors ($184,000), press downtime ($220,300), and bindery waste ($47,600) are internal - failure costs. Total internal - failure cost=$27,300 + $36,000+ $184,000+ $220,300+ $47,600 = $515,200.
  • External - failure costs occur when defects are found after the product reaches the customer. Customer complaint remakes ($21,700) is an external - failure cost.

Step2: Calculate total quality cost

Total quality cost = Prevention cost+Appraisal cost + Internal - failure cost+External - failure cost = $68,600 + $544,400+ $515,200+ $21,700=$1,149,900

Step3: Calculate percentage of total quality cost by category

Prevention percentage = $\frac{68,600}{1,149,900}\times100%\approx6.14%$ Appraisal percentage = $\frac{544,400}{1,149,900}\times100%\approx47.34%$ Internal - failure percentage = $\frac{515,200}{1,149,900}\times100%\approx44.80%$ External - failure percentage = $\frac{21,700}{1,149,900}\times100%\approx1.90%$

Answer:

Quality Cost Category Total Amount Percentage of Total Quality Cost
Prevention $68,600 6.14%
Appraisal $544,400 47.34%
Internal failure $515,200 44.80%
External failure $21,700 1.90%
